Job Description

You are a member of the European and Multilateral Affairs (DAEM) Directorate within the Group, International and Institutional Relations (DIRI) Directorate.

The DAEM has a mission of expertise and lobbying with European and multilateral institutions (ICAO, NATO in particular)

The Defence, Space and Security Business Officer is responsible for Safran's interface (regulations, programmes and funds) with EU and NATO institutions, and for promoting Safran products and technologies in multilateral markets.

It coordinates the Group's subsidiaries in these two areas of activity.

Missions:

  • Monitoring, analysis and definition of influence plans and contacts throughout the decision-making process of European regulations or programmes.

  • Producing analysis, synthesis and positions, and presentations

  • Coordination of Safran's positions with the aerospace-defense ecosystem, through participation in the work of national and European federations.

  • Development of networks of contacts in institutions and agencies

  • Representing Safran at meetings of associations and events in the aeronautics and defence trade shows.

  • Analysis of issues and opportunities, identification of power and decision-making networks in the institutions and agencies of the EU and NATO

  • Management of Safran Bus and central functions with institutional decision-makers

  • Coordination of the network of internal experts involved in multilateral defence programmes

  • Organization of meetings and events for Safran Executive Committee members
